Kill changeThis one is normally enabled by default, and a few VPNs (like Mullvad) don’t even allow you to disable it. And for good cause: The kill change is arguably essentially the most important VPN privateness function. It routinely kills your web connection if the VPN unexpectedly disconnects, serving to be sure that your on-line exercise isn’t inadvertently leaked to your web supplier or community administrator. Having your kill change enabled is necessary at any time, however particularly when the privateness of your on-line exercise is paramount. If your VPN doesn’t embrace a kill change, you must begin on the lookout for a distinct VPN instantly. DNS leak protectionNot each service does, but when your VPN has a separate setting for DNS leak safety, ensure that it’s enabled always. DNS leak safety helps be sure that your DNS requests — makes an attempt to entry a web site — are resolved by the VPN supplier’s encrypted DNS servers quite than by your web supplier’s. If your gadget bypasses the VPN tunnel and sends your DNS requests to your web supplier, a DNS leak happens and your web exercise might be uncovered. You can simply verify for DNS leaks by connecting to a VPN server and checking a web site like ipleak.web or dnsleaktest.com. Secure VPN protocol like OpenVPN, WireGuard or equivalentNot all VPN protocols are equal. For optimum privateness, I like to recommend utilizing both OpenVPN, WireGuard or an equal proprietary VPN protocol, if out there. OpenVPN is a safe, time- and battle-tested VPN protocol that delivers respectable speeds coupled with air-tight privateness. WireGuard is a more recent protocol that usually provides you quicker speeds whereas providing comparable privateness protections. Some VPNs like ExpressVPN and NordVPN have developed their very own proprietary protocols that additionally provide quick speeds and top-notch privateness. NordVPN and others like Proton VPN and Windscribe additionally provide devoted obfuscation protocols that purpose to disguise your VPN site visitors as common web site visitors that will help you evade firewalls. Getty Image/ Zooey Liao/ CNETObfuscationIf you’re in a area that restricts or outlaws VPN use (or if you happen to’re on a restricted community in school or work), you’ll need to conceal the truth that you’re utilizing a VPN within the first place. Obfuscation is a instrument many VPNs present that may enable you to try this. Some VPN suppliers, like Windscribe, NordVPN and Proton VPN, have devoted obfuscation-focused protocols you should use to attempt to conceal your VPN use. Surfshark has obfuscation baked into its OpenVPN implementation, and ExpressVPN routinely prompts its obfuscation expertise when it detects community interference. Other VPNs have specialty servers particularly devoted to obfuscating VPN site visitors. Obfuscation is essential for getting round restrictive firewalls and bypassing censorship efforts, however if you happen to’re dwelling in a rustic the place VPNs are unlawful, needless to say obfuscation could not have a 100% success charge. Post-quantum encryptionMore and extra of the highest VPNs are starting to roll out post-quantum encryption, which is designed to guard customers in opposition to potential future threats from quantum computer systems. Depending in your VPN supplier, post-quantum encryption could also be a separate setting you may toggle on or off, or it’d routinely be enabled when utilizing a particular VPN protocol. Even although we’re nonetheless years away from quantum computing being a menace to trendy encryption, post-quantum encryption remains to be necessary to have now to guard in opposition to attackers who could try to intercept encrypted site visitors now in hopes of decrypting it later with quantum computer systems. Multi-hopMultihop, generally known as double-hop or double VPN, routes your connection by two VPN servers as a substitute of only one. This widespread function provides you an additional layer of encryption and might make it even tougher to trace you on-line. While multi-hop is perhaps overkill for many VPN customers, it may well add a bit of additional peace of thoughts for somebody with important privateness wants who must take further precautions. In addition to multi-hop, some VPN suppliers like NordVPN and Proton VPN additionally embrace a Tor over VPN function, which routes your VPN connection by the Tor community and is one other manner so as to add a layer of encryption and increase your privateness. Getty Image/ Zooey Liao/ CNETIPv6 leak protectionIPv6 leaks can occur when your gadget or a web site you’re visiting makes use of IPv6 and your VPN isn’t configured to deal with IPv6 site visitors, inflicting that site visitors to route exterior the encrypted VPN tunnel. This can expose your on-line exercise to your web supplier. Although some VPN suppliers are rolling out full IPv6 assist, many nonetheless don’t assist IPv6 site visitors and as a substitute are both configured to dam IPv6 site visitors altogether or have an IPv6 leak safety setting you may toggle on or off. Auto-connectEspecially if you happen to’re touring and connecting to totally different public Wi-Fi networks, a VPN auto-connect function can come in useful. This manner, you may have your VPN routinely join whenever you boot up your pc or launch your VPN app so that you don’t danger forgetting to connect with the VPN on sure networks. Depending on the VPN, you may configure the auto-connect function to routinely join when on all networks, unknown networks or particular networks that you just designate.
